Studies have revealed that healthy and balanced diet can result in clear and glowing skin.


Studies have concluded that the consumption of all the processed sugary and starchy foods people have these days such as candy bars, chips, doughnuts, burgers, soda, pizza and white breads takes a toll with acne and some other skin problems.


But you need not to worry about it that much since there is always a solution to any problem. Following are some of the benefits of some useful food items one must include in their diet plan.



  • Vitamin A: Deals with inflammation, encourages cell turnover for natural exfoliation and strengthens your skin’s defense against blocked pores. Add spinach salad with tomatoes to your daily diet and see what happens. Reap all the benefits of vitamin A by pairing it with zinc, which helps the transportation of vitamin A from your liver to all of your body tissues, including your skin.

  • Zinc: An acne combatant, zinc helps in the regulation of sebum production, stopping shine and preventing more breakouts. Add 1 cup chickpeas or 1/4 cup pumpkin seeds to that salad already discussed previously for skin glows without looking greasy.

  • Omega-3s: The right oils can help restock lipid-starved skin from the inside, sealing in moisture, nourishing and soothing inflammation that can result from dryness. Consider adding flax oil to the dressing in the above mentioned salad to slake your skin.

  • Whole Grains: If you have an acne prone skin, try this experiment. Cut refined carbohydrates from your diet and add in high-fiber grains and see the results in the coming months for yourself. You’ll be surprised with the outcomes. All of the processed carbohydrates cause your pancreas to send out a rush of insulin, leading to a hormonal reaction that increases oil production and cells start to multiply. All of which clog those pores.

  • Probiotics: These beneficial bacteria help make your skin soft. When your intestines are working right, they can better absorb all of the nutrients your skin needs from your diet. Keeping the salad in mind, you can get your pro biotic fix by adding fermented veggies such as pickles.

  • Raw Veggies and Fruits: They are the best sources to have all that your skin needs to have, vegetables and fruits are small packs of energy and useful nutrients much needed to have radiant and glowing skin.


All of this adds up to one good, wholesome salad which can give you soft, smooth and radiant skin you always want to have.
